Är CBC Mac säker?
Är CBC Mac säker?

Video: Är CBC Mac säker?

Video: Är CBC Mac säker?
Video: 347 CBC MAC 2024, April
Anonim

Givet a säkra blockchiffer, CBC - MAC är säkra för meddelanden med fast längd. Men i sig är det inte det säkra för meddelanden med variabel längd.

I detta avseende, är CBC Mac kollisionsbeständig?

Detta exempel visar också att en CBC - MAC kan inte användas som en kollision - resistent enkelriktad funktion: med en nyckel är det trivialt att skapa ett annat meddelande som "hashasar" till samma tagg.

På samma sätt, hur fungerar CBC Mac? Med CBC (Cipher Block Chaining)- MAC (Message Authentication Code) vi autentiserar meddelanden med en hemlig delad nyckel. Om de är samma sak, då har Bob fortsatt att bevisa sin identitet (som bara han burk har den hemliga nyckeln som Bob och Alice delar), och att meddelandet inte har ändrats.

För det andra, är CBC säkert?

Attackerna mot RC4 och CBC har lämnat oss med väldigt få val för kryptografiska algoritmer som är säker från attack i samband med TLS. Faktum är att det inte finns några chiffer som stöds av TLS 1.1 eller tidigare säker . De enda alternativen är CBC läges chiffer eller RC4.

Vad är storleken i bitar av CBC Mac när den används med DES-kryptering?

I fallet med CBC - MAC med trippel- DES det är storlek av blocket av 3DES som är 64- bit (eller en kortare bit av det). Om din data är längre än så kan du inte "dekryptera" den, eftersom det finns flera lösningar nu.

Rekommenderad: